What affects the price

Replacing your water heater involves several variables that change the final bill. The biggest factor is the unit type—tankless models usually cost more upfront than traditional tank-style heaters due to installation complexity. You also have to consider the fuel source, as switching from gas to electric often requires electrical panel upgrades. Size matters too; a larger home needs a unit with higher recovery rates. Finally, local building codes might require additional safety equipment, like expansion tanks or updated venting.

How long do hot water heaters typically last?

Traditional tank water heaters usually last between 10-15 years, but tankless models can often go for 20 years or more with proper maintenance. What is the most efficient type of water heater?

Tankless water heaters are generally considered the most efficient type because they heat water on demand, meaning they don't waste energy keeping a large tank of water hot 24/7. What are signs I need a new water heater?

Common signs include a lack of hot water, rusty or discolored water, strange noises like banging or popping, and leaks around the base of the unit. The pros can diagnose the issue and advise on repair or replacement.

What is the most common problem with a hot water heater?

Sediment buildup in the tank is a very common issue that can reduce efficiency and cause noises. For tankless units, mineral buildup in the heat exchanger can also be a problem.
